Fees are subject to assessment, room and availability.
Included in weekly fees: fully furnished en-suite wet room, 32" flat screen television, own private telephone, spa baths, use of cinema, medication support, 7 day a week activities, regular trips in the mini bus, care, all freshly cooked food and drink, house keeping, laundry.
These prices are only a guideline, please contact Rokewood Court to find out the exact price for your requirements.

I am the Lead Wellbeing & Lifestyle Coordinator at Rokewood Court, Kenley. I am responsible for putting together a timetable of activities and events for residents covering everything from physical, social, experimental, emotional/spiritual, creative/artistic, therapeutic and sensory activities.
I spent 37 years working as a library supervisor for the Borough of Croydon, where I managed teams at the Central Library and its 12 branches. I am a singer/songwriter/performer and have had a 35 year career performing in theatres and concert halls, having released 4 original albums of self-penned songs (all available on Spotify). I am a book author and have written and published 7 non-fiction books on everything from religion to history and biography. I am a recipient of the Diocese of Southwark’s Bishop’s Certificate and have been on Pilgrimage to the Holy Land.
I am married (23 years ago in Liverpool) and have girl/boy twins now age 16. I love good food and fine wine, good comedy and great music.

What I do
I am the Hospitality Supervisor here at Rokewood Court. I am responsible for ensuring that our residents have an enjoyable dining experience and that they receive exceptional customer service. I also help to look after our busy Lancaster Cafe and make our lounge areas a pleasant place to relax in.
My experience
I have worked in many roles within the hospitality industry. I was Hospitality Manager at HM Treasury for 5 years, overseeing events at Downing Street. I also worked as an Assistant Conference Manager at Morgan Stanley in Canary Wharf. Earlier in my career, I worked at Addington Palace. This beautiful historic venue hosted elaborate weddings and parties.
